|
|
afe06213de
|
chore(nvim): update lazy-lock.json
|
2026-01-09 23:54:34 +08:00 |
|
|
|
df0a21913e
|
feat: tidy shell config
|
2026-01-03 10:09:43 +08:00 |
|
|
|
a56e9bdaf2
|
chore(nvim): update lazy-lock.json
|
2026-01-01 17:41:40 +08:00 |
|
|
|
e574a70020
|
feat(nvim): enable inlay hints for rust-analyzer
|
2026-01-01 15:39:04 +08:00 |
|
|
|
b3cd3fe209
|
feat(nvim): tidy old config; track lazy-lock.json
|
2025-12-31 22:06:51 +08:00 |
|
|
|
7eb32cfabc
|
feat: impure symlink
|
2025-12-28 11:07:50 +08:00 |
|
|
|
6482506cc3
|
fix(nvim): nixd nixpkgs
|
2025-12-21 10:58:24 +08:00 |
|
|
|
454ad5885d
|
feat: massive refactor
|
2025-12-20 23:05:28 +08:00 |
|
|
|
f4c1b313ce
|
fix(server): nixpkgs config; migrate to new frp module
|
2025-12-20 20:45:33 +08:00 |
|
|
|
bc197eb3ca
|
refactor: massive refactor using flake-parts; use typos-cli and
keep-sorted
|
2025-12-20 18:12:03 +08:00 |
|
|
|
8d7a4aed01
|
feat(direnv): configure
|
2025-12-07 12:46:43 +08:00 |
|
|
|
15ac780c9d
|
feat(langs/c): use clang
|
2025-11-29 15:16:14 +08:00 |
|
|
|
4ae4f3bb2b
|
feat(nvim): typst; tidy language specific configurations
|
2025-11-23 14:49:31 +08:00 |
|
|
|
4d0cd7b1e7
|
chore: update flake.lock; use treefmt
|
2025-11-15 14:54:08 +08:00 |
|
|
|
5a671c3ece
|
feat(nvim): nvim-colorizer
|
2025-10-18 12:57:59 +08:00 |
|
|
|
9696d4f343
|
chore: update flake.lock
|
2025-10-18 01:04:48 +08:00 |
|
|
|
4218dbeb80
|
feat(langs/js): use pnpm
|
2025-10-17 19:52:40 +08:00 |
|
|
|
f07598688f
|
chore(nvim): tidy
|
2025-10-04 14:55:23 +08:00 |
|
|
|
e696472c5b
|
feat(nvim): glance.nvim
|
2025-10-04 14:54:36 +08:00 |
|
|
|
dcfd134a4e
|
feat(nvim): close nvim-tree when its the only window left
|
2025-10-04 14:53:46 +08:00 |
|
|
|
faba8a05e6
|
refactor: my.home -> my.hm for disambiguilty (e.g. my.home.home)
|
2025-10-03 22:17:36 +08:00 |
|
|
|
1eaee50e82
|
feat(nvim): enable exrc; drop unused file
|
2025-10-02 16:45:19 +08:00 |
|
|
|
90f0b4aa63
|
fix(nvim): rust-analyzer config
It has been broken for thousands of years.
|
2025-08-26 21:52:08 +08:00 |
|
|
|
c61b1e8961
|
feat(nvim): prevent accidental <S-up> and <S-down>
|
2025-08-24 21:50:28 +08:00 |
|
|
|
e958163479
|
feat(nvim): move language servers to each language's .nix file
|
2025-08-13 09:18:49 +08:00 |
|
|
|
8385671c4f
|
chore: drop unused packages
|
2025-08-04 20:45:39 +08:00 |
|
|
|
244844242f
|
feat(langs): java
|
2025-08-02 18:05:56 +08:00 |
|
|
|
5da17890cb
|
feat(langs/rust): add ~/.cargo/bin to PATH
|
2025-07-30 22:34:51 +08:00 |
|
|
|
0ed99176ad
|
chore: update flake.lock
|
2025-07-22 15:51:48 +08:00 |
|
|
|
4dddb0e803
|
chore(nvim): drop outdated config
|
2025-07-22 15:17:31 +08:00 |
|
|
|
abdc2f5c6c
|
feat(coding/langs): QML
|
2025-07-06 14:29:49 +08:00 |
|
|
|
28c59be2a7
|
feat(nvim): add leap.nvim
|
2025-06-29 15:16:30 +08:00 |
|
|
|
51b882f2c5
|
feat: add ~/.npm-global/bin to PATH
|
2025-06-29 15:16:30 +08:00 |
|
|
|
13b69ccc95
|
refactor: persist
|
2025-06-29 15:16:30 +08:00 |
|
|
|
8fe373eeb5
|
chore: drop useless github-cli-comp
|
2025-06-27 23:21:52 +08:00 |
|
|
|
0c679290c5
|
feat: zed-editor
|
2025-06-21 22:55:37 +08:00 |
|
|
|
13cc8234e1
|
feat: move to umport for automatic module import
|
2025-06-21 11:30:35 +08:00 |
|
|
|
2f170b9e08
|
fix(nvim): ident-blankline should be loaded earlier
|
2025-06-15 09:12:57 +08:00 |
|
|
|
b762cb91fe
|
feat(nvim): tweak lazy.nvim
|
2025-06-15 09:10:35 +08:00 |
|
|
|
53e15c2324
|
chore(nvim): a lot
format, fix nvim-tree startup, update telescope, drop unused plugins
|
2025-06-14 19:47:08 +08:00 |
|
|
|
6a1889722c
|
fix(nvim): diagnostic sign
|
2025-06-14 19:27:05 +08:00 |
|
|
|
ae231ba132
|
feat(nvim): tidy old config, improve startup time
|
2025-06-14 19:26:45 +08:00 |
|
|
|
ad5e7aa5e7
|
fix(neovim): remove unecessary override
|
2025-06-07 15:50:28 +08:00 |
|
|
|
c477dbeae6
|
feat(nvim): better outline icon
|
2025-05-31 15:32:57 +08:00 |
|
|
|
dea4d8ed4c
|
feat: 0517 update
|
2025-05-17 23:15:16 +08:00 |
|
|
|
3a12722913
|
chore: replace { ... } with _
|
2025-05-10 19:07:06 +08:00 |
|
|
|
64d4085b98
|
feat: nixd
|
2025-05-10 12:40:10 +08:00 |
|
|
|
e380732f90
|
fix(nvim): diagnostic sign
|
2025-05-10 12:38:35 +08:00 |
|
|
|
27041ff1fa
|
feat(nvim): switch virtual_lines
|
2025-05-04 10:58:47 +08:00 |
|
|
|
bf1539e914
|
fix: vscode
|
2025-05-04 10:58:16 +08:00 |
|